    My sister just got a new laptop (HP DV6810), and it can connect to our wireless home network, sometimes. However the connection keeps dropping out every 20 mins or so.

    The router is in my bedroom upstairs (Linksys WRT54GS) and it is wired to my desktop pc. My sister uses her laptop mainly downstairs but also sometimes in her bedroom which is next to mine.

    Anyone have an idea of what the problem could be?

    Her computer should show a signal-strength indicator if the mouse is hovered over the network connection icon in the lower right corner of the screen.

    As a test, move her computer into the room with router and see whether this still happens.
